I recently read a blog post by an Agent who didn't see any value in Staging a property for sale.  This particular Agent felt the cost of such a service was unnecessary and that all that really mattered in getting the home sold was (basically) the price.  I agree on one point: Price is King!    That said, allow me to share with you (and prove) that staging CAN be a viable factor in getting your property not only sold, but for a higher price than possibly expected...

This is a sort of "part two" (if you will) from a previous post I submitted back in late August: "Inspiration from one piece of furniture"    The big difference, in this scenario, is that I had more than one piece to work with...I had 3 items (in the living area).  Woo Hoo!  But, they were good anchor pieces that worked with the space and the Seller was so wonderful to work with. We also didn't have to bring in any books (yay) and there were a few art pieces I thought were great and easily incorporated into the whole look.

I've got a Sofa, a Coffee table, and a Bookcase...ready...and..."ACTION"!

SCENE 1:  Single Family Home, priced to sell.  On the market for 60 days...no bites. 

SCENE 2: Property is temporarily withdrawn from market, staged and refreshed on the MLS (AT THE SAME LISTING PRICE as before).

SCENE 3: Property is in contract at a price 3% above asking (about $27,000 in this case) after one week on the market.  Cost of staging entire home where needed: $3,800)

SCENE 4: Very happy Seller. 

 

Here are the "Before and After's" of the Living Room area that helped knock this one out of the ballpark...
